This module was created to generate {{cite web}} references to the Catalog of Fishes database. The capabilities were extended to handle other fish-related references and the module renamed FishRef. Further extension to cover taxonomy databases handling non-fish taxa led to creation of template {{BioRef}}. A general {{Cite taxon}} template and module to handle citations to a wide variety taxonomy database is the long-term goal.

The module provides a wrapper to the cite web system, which means that the references can also include general cite web parameters (e.g. |mode=cs1|2or|quote=TEXT).

The module is used with {{Catalog of Fishes}}, which was designed to replace a series of templates that were originally written in the Wikipedia template language: {{Cof genus}}, {{Cof family}}, {{Cof species}}, {{Cof record}}.

Other templates using the module:

* The module currently handles ASW6, Amphibiaweb, Reptile Database, IOC, Avibase, TiF, WoRMS, POWO, GRIN, IPNI, World Plants, World Ferns, Tropicos, FNA, ATRF, Goffinet's Bryophyte classification, Algaebase, Paleobiology DB, ITIS

Usage of module: {{#invoke:FishRef|cof}}, {{#invoke:FishRef|fishbase}}, {{#invoke:FishRef|fossilworks}}, etc.
